Microchip PIC12C508A-04I/SN 8-Bit Microcontroller Datasheet and Application Overview

Release date:2026-02-24 Number of clicks:116

Microchip PIC12C508A-04I/SN 8-Bit Microcontroller Datasheet and Application Overview

The Microchip PIC12C508A-04I/SN is a cornerstone of the PIC12C5XX family of 8-bit, fully static, EEPROM-based microcontrollers. Housed in a compact 8-pin SOIC (SN) package and rated for the industrial temperature range (-40°C to +85°C), this device is engineered for space-constrained, cost-sensitive, and high-volume applications that demand reliability and performance. Its architecture integrates all the hallmarks of a classic PIC microcontroller—high performance, low power consumption, and exceptional ease of use—into a minimal footprint.

Core Architectural Features

At the heart of the PIC12C508A lies a high-performance RISC CPU. The core features a reduced instruction set (RISC) of only 33 single-word instructions, making programming straightforward and enabling very fast execution. Most instructions are single-cycle (400 ns at 4 MHz), while program branches require two cycles. This efficiency ensures rapid response to real-time events.

The device is equipped with 512 x 12-bit words of user-programmable EEPROM for program memory and 25 bytes of RAM for data. This memory configuration is optimally suited for a vast array of simple control tasks, from sensor interfacing to logic replacement. A critical feature for robust system design is the integrated watchdog timer (WDT) with its own on-chip RC oscillator, ensuring reliable operation and recovery from software malfunctions.

On-Chip Peripherals and I/O

Despite its small size, the PIC12C508A-04I/SN packs a powerful set of peripherals. It offers 6 I/O pins, each capable of sourcing or sinking significant current, allowing them to drive LEDs or other peripherals directly. One pin can be configured as a weak pull-up on the GP3/!MCLR/VPP pin, simplifying input interface design.

A key feature is the 8-bit real-time clock/counter (TMR0) with an 8-bit programmable prescaler, providing essential timing and event counting capabilities. Furthermore, the device includes a precision internal 4 MHz oscillator, calibrated at the factory. This eliminates the need for an external crystal or resonator for many applications, further reducing component count, board space, and system cost.

Power Management and Operating Characteristics

Designed for low-power operation, the PIC12C508A supports a wide operating voltage range of 2.5V to 5.5V. This flexibility allows it to function in both battery-powered and line-operated systems. It exhibits very low current consumption, typically less than 2 mA at 5V, 4 MHz, and features multiple power-down modes, including SLEEP mode, where current consumption can drop to the microamp range, making it ideal for portable and always-on applications.

Application Overview

The combination of its tiny form factor, integrated oscillator, and robust I/O makes the PIC12C508A-04I/SN a perfect solution for a multitude of applications. It is extensively used as a dedicated logic replacement, consolidating multiple discrete logic chips into a single, programmable component. Its capabilities are ideal for:

Consumer electronics (appliance control, remote controls, toys)

Automotive systems (sensor interfaces, small actuator control)

Peripheral interfaces for larger systems

Smart sensors and portable devices requiring low-power operation

ICGOOODFIND: The Microchip PIC12C508A-04I/SN demonstrates that significant processing and control capability can be effectively delivered in an extremely small package. Its integrated oscillator, watchdog timer, and sleep mode create a highly self-contained system-on-chip, minimizing external components and maximizing reliability for embedded control pioneers.

Keywords: 8-bit Microcontroller, Low-Power, Integrated Oscillator, SOIC-8, RISC Architecture

Home
TELEPHONE CONSULTATION
Whatsapp
VIA Technologies Processors & Motherboards on ICGOODFIND